The Washington Capitals traveled to Tampa Bay to take on the Lightning with their dads and mentors in tow. They took some of that transitive dad strength and used it to put down the Bolts 5-2 for yet another road victory.
The Caps out-shot the Lightning 34 to 28, but were out-attempted at five-on-five 41 to 37.

- Overall, another great road game from the Caps. They survived the Lightning’s sometimes lengthy second period offensive pushes and shut the door right in their face to open the third with two quick goals. Need to stay out of the box though.
- Ilya Samsonov was at times utterly magnificent in the first NHL game he has played with his father in attendance. The rookie netminder made 26 saves on 28 shots in his eighth career win and now has a 2.38 goals against average and a 91.8 save percentage this season. He leads all qualified rookie goalies in wins, goals against average, and save percentage.

- Evgeny Kuznetsov is slowly and somewhat quietly climbing the Caps point leaders list. He is now only one point behind Ovi for second on the team to John Carlson. His assist in Tampa gives him points in four straight.
- I thought the Dmitry Orlov and Nick Jensen pairing were flying the entire night. They hardly put a foot wrong and it shows on the stat sheet as well. With Jensen on the ice five-on-five the Caps controlled 68-percent of the shot attempts, 68.8-percent of the scoring chances, and 66.7-percent of the high danger chances.
